can fish fingers be grilled?
Fish fingers are a versatile and convenient food that can be prepared in a variety of ways. Grilling is a great option for cooking fish fingers, as it gives them a crispy outer coating and a tender, flaky interior. To grill fish fingers, simply preheat your grill to medium heat and grease the grates. Place the fish fingers on the grill and cook for 5-7 minutes per side, or until they are cooked through. You can also brush the fish fingers with a little bit of oil or butter to help them brown. Once the fish fingers are cooked, remove them from the grill and serve immediately. They can be enjoyed on their own or with a variety of dipping sauces, such as tartar sauce, ketchup, or mayonnaise.

how long do birdseye fish fingers take to cook?
Birdseye fish fingers are a quick and convenient meal option that can be cooked in a variety of ways. The cooking time will vary depending on the method you choose, but generally, they can be cooked in about 10-12 minutes. If you are cooking them in the oven, preheat your oven to 400 degrees Fahrenheit and bake them for 10-12 minutes, or until they are golden brown and cooked through. If you are cooking them in the microwave, cook them on high for 2-3 minutes per side, or until they are cooked through. You can also cook them in a skillet over medium heat for 5-7 minutes per side, or until they are golden brown and cooked through. No matter which method you choose, be sure to cook the fish fingers until they are cooked through to ensure they are safe to eat.
how long do jumbo fish fingers take to cook?
Jumbo fish fingers are a convenient and delicious meal option, offering a tasty and nutritious alternative to traditional fish dishes. Cooking jumbo fish fingers is a simple process that can be completed in a matter of minutes. To ensure that the fish fingers are cooked thoroughly and evenly, it is important to follow the cooking instructions provided on the packaging. Typically, jumbo fish fingers can be cooked in a preheated oven at 400 degrees Fahrenheit for approximately 15-20 minutes. Alternatively, they can be cooked in a deep fryer at 375 degrees Fahrenheit for 3-4 minutes. Regardless of the cooking method, it is crucial to monitor the fish fingers closely to prevent overcooking. Overcooked fish fingers can become dry and tough, compromising their flavor and texture. To ensure that the fish fingers are cooked to perfection, it is recommended to use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ature, which should reach 165 degrees Fahrenheit. Once cooked, jumbo fish fingers can be served with a variety of accompaniments, such as tartar sauce, lemon wedges, or a side salad.
can you cook fish fingers in a frying pan?
To prepare the fish fingers, you want to make sure the pan is filled with enough oil for deep frying. Turn the stove to medium. Once the oil is hot, carefully lay a few fish fingers into the hot oil. Leave them to fry undisturbed until golden brown on one side. When this side is golden brown, flip the fish fingers over and let the other side cook until crispy and cooked through. Place the cooked fish fingers on paper towels to drain any excess oil. Finally, season the fish fingers with salt and pepper and serve with your favorite dipping sauce. A side note, a great way to keep the fish fingers even crispier is to transfer them to an oven tray coated with baking paper and place them in the oven for a few minutes.

can you cook fish fingers in the toaster?
Can you cook fish fingers in the toaster? No, you should not cook fish fingers in the toaster. It is dangerous and can cause a fire. The toaster is not designed to cook fish fingers and it can overheat, causing the fish fingers to catch fire. Additionally, the toaster does not provide even cooking, so the fish fingers may not be cooked properly. It is best to cook fish fingers in a pan or in the oven, according to the package instructions.
